- The distance between Sao Carlos, Brazil and Mindat, Myanmar is approximately 16,082 km or 9,993 mi.
- To reach Sao Carlos in this distance one would set out from Mindat bearing 261.7°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Sao Carlos bearing 263.7° or W .
- Sao Carlos has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Mindat has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Sao Carlos is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Mindat is in or near the subtropical wet for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 0.1 °C (0.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.5 °C (6.3°F) less in Sao Carlos.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 93.1 mm (3.7 in) more which is equivalent to 93.1 l/m² (2.28 US gal/ft²) or 931,000 l/ha (99,530 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.3° lower in Sao Carlos than in Mindat.
